HE was the star footy player, turned schoolteacher, with blond hair and a fitness fanatics’ physique.

In the 1970s and ’80s, Chris Dawson was a handsome, successful and charming man, liked by men and women alike.

He would use those looks and charm to woo at least one schoolgirl from Cromer State High into his bed in the early 1980s.

That relationship and the subsequent disappearance and suspected murder of his wife Lynette Dawson, is the subject of the number one podcast in the country, The Teacher’s Pet.

In the 1970s Dawson was a professional footy player with the Newtown Jets in the New South Wales Rugby League, playing alongside his twin brother, Paul Dawson.

Their coach was Paul Broughton, a founding father of the Gold Coast Titans.

In his playing days Dawson was known as Cranky Chris, due to his temperament on the footy field, while his brother was known as Passive Paul.

Dawson was also a part-time model for jeans and corn chips during his playing days.

The Dawson brothers were well known in the northern beaches of Sydney, a pair of athletically handsome, identical twins who would go on long runs together.

It appeared he had it all going for him, a decent sporting career, marrying his high school sweetheart Lynette Simms, having two kids and transitioning into becoming a schoolteacher.

Following his retirement from professional footy in the late 1970s, Dawson became a physical education teacher at Cromer High School, where he would meet Joanne Curtis, a Year 11 student of his.

Curtis became the family babysitter and Dawson’s manipulative and physical relationship with the schoolgirl began. The sneaking around would continue through to when Joanne graduated from high school in 1981.

Lyn disappeared shortly after, between January 8-9, 1982. Just days later, Joanne Curtis had moved into the Dawson home.

Dawson and Curtis would marry, have a child together and move to the Gold Coast by 1985, where he would go on to teach at Keebra State High and Coombabah State High School.

He was followed in tow by his brother Paul, also a PE teacher, and his wife and kids.

Between 2001-2003, two inquests were held into the disappearance of Lynette Dawson, with coroner’s finding on both occasions that Lyn was murdered by Chris Dawson in 1982.

No charges were levelled at Dawson, with the Director of Public Prosecutions ruling there was

insufficient evidence. Mr Dawson has always maintained he is innocent.

Now living freely in Noosa with his third wife, Chris Dawson is known to attend Gold Coast Titans training and games when he comes to visit his twin brother on the Coast.

Dawson has refused to take part in the Teacher’s Pet podcast.

TIMELINE

1970 — 1979

Chris Dawson marries Lynette Simms, both aged 21. They have two daughters together and Chris begins working as a PE teacher at Cromer High School

1980

Chris begins a secret affair with Joanne Curtis, 16, his student, soon after introducing her to his family as the babysitter. He starts asking her to marry him.

1981

Lyn is persuaded by Chris to let Joanne move into their family home as the teenager’s stepfather is violent. Lyn discovers the relationship.

December 1981

Chris flees Sydney with Joanne to start a new life in Queensland, but Joanne has second thoughts and they turn around and return to Sydney.

January 1982

Joanne goes camping with her sister and school friends to mark the end of their schooling. Chris and Lyn go to marriage counselling together.

January 8, 1982

Lyn speaks with her mum on the phone, the next day, Lyn fails to meet her family at Northbridge Baths as planned.

January 10-11, 1982

One or two days after Lyn’s no-show at the pool, Chris drives up the Central Cost to pick up Joanne and they return to Sydney. He asks Joanne to move in with him. He does not report Lyn missing until almost six weeks later.

1983-1985

Chris divorces the missing Lyn and marries Joanne. The couple move to Queensland and have a daughter together.

1985

Chris starts working at Keebra Park State High School.

1990

Joanne and Chris separate and she returns to Sydney. She contacts Lyn’s family and police and provides information about Chris and Lyn.

1992-2000

Areas of the Dawsons’ former Sydney home are excavated by police on different occasions, and a woman’s cardigan is found, in pieces and bearing what appear to be slash marks. Forensic testing does not make a positive match with Lyn.

2001-2003

Two inquests are held into Lyn’s disappearance. Two coroners find she was murdered by someone known to her. Chris does not appear at either inquest. The DPP does not support a prosecution for murder or the laying of charges, citing a lack of evidence.

2010 — 2014

Rewards of up to $200,000 are offered for information to help solve the case.
